Is it legal to make a documentary about someone?
Filmmakers working on documentaries or biographies should have each of their subjects sign a Life Rights Consent Agreement. Typically, a Life Rights Consent Agreement grants to the filmmaker the following rights: The right to portray a particular person's life in whole or in part.

What are the rules of making a documentary?
The 10 Rules of Personal Documentary Filmmaking By Doug Block RULE #1: Don't make it all about you (even though, of course, it's all about you) RULE #2: A personal doc is not your personal therapy. RULE #3: Don't tell us your feelings. ... Rule #4: A sense of humor is essential (especially self-deprecating humor)

Do you need release forms for a documentary?
If you're making a documentary style video and you have the consent of an employer to film in their workplace you still need to get release forms signed by their individual employees that you film because an employer cannot consent on their employees behalf.

Do you have to pay someone to make a documentary about them?
Generally speaking, no, you should not be paying your documentary subjects.
-
Can you sue someone for putting you in a documentary?
The most likely grounds upon which to sue for an unauthorized portrayal are defamation, invasion of privacy, right of publicity and unfair competition.
